Wall Mounted Electric Fireplace Heater
A wall-mounted electric fireplace is a great method of heating your home and improving the appearance of your home. They are simple to install and do not require a chimney.
They are also safer than traditional fires as they do not release smoke or ash. This makes them an excellent choice for homes that have children or pets.

Examining your requirements and goals is the first step in choosing the right model. For efficient heating, calculate the area you want to heat. Then look for a heater with wattage that matches. If you plan to use the fireplace primarily for ambiance, consider a compact model with realistic flames and an adjustable brightness. Select a simple design that will blend in with your decor if you prefer an elegant or minimalist style. If you're looking for an immersive experience, consider an electric fireplace with Holographic technology that creates a lifelike flame display.
Some models also feature zonal heating, allowing you to concentrate warmth on certain areas of your space without heating areas that aren't being used. Many electric fireplaces have thermostats and adjustable settings for heat that allow you to maintain the desired temperature.

Safety
Although some people are still under the belief that wall-mounted electric fireplace heaters are dangerous for homes, these appliances are actually quite safe. They do not contain flames, but rather a projection of flames that create a soothing illusion. The heat they produce is distributed only in the air around the heating element and is not directly contacting furniture or walls.
They are also safer than ventless gas fireplaces because they don't emit deadly carbon monoxide. These fireplaces do not require a chimney or flue and can be installed by homeowners without professional help.
They also have safety screens that keep children and pets from touching the heating element or any flammable material like bricks or glass. They are designed to shut off when they detect an excessive amount of heat, thus preventing the spread of fire and minimizing the risk of injury.
If you decide to put your electric fire on the wall, be sure to select a location where it is secure fixed to the studs behind the drywall. It is also essential to know the location of the electrical outlet. The top models shouldn't be placed just above the outlet since it could cause the cord to overheat. Front and bottom models should be set at minimum 1.5 feet away from the outlet to avoid tripping hazards.
